Mrs. William (Adelaide S.) Tills, 93, a resident of Pikes Peak Manor, Colorado Springs, Colo., a former Manitowoc resident, died Wednesday evening, August 14, at Colorado Springs.
Funeral services will [be at] 11 a.m. Monday at First Lutheran Chapel, Manitowoc. The Rev. Richard E. Lind will officiate and burial will be in Evergreen Cemetery, Manitowoc.
Mrs. Tills was born Sept. 14, 1891, at Chicago, Ill., daughter of the late Axel and Marianne Olsen Petersen. She was raised in Chicago moving to Manitowoc as a young girl and graduated from The Old Northside High School in Manitowoc and then attending Manitowoc County Normal. She taught school at Rockwood Public Schools for a few years. Mrs. Tills live in Manitowoc most of her life moving to Colorado in 1978. She was married to William J. Tills, May 23, 1917. He preceded her in death Oct. 3, 1957. Mrs. Tills was a member of First Lutheran Church, Manitowoc.
Survivors include two daughters and sons-in-law, Helen and Carroll Sorenson of Neenah, Wis. and Jean and Roland Aplin of Colorado Springs, Colo; eight grandchildren, Christina Sorenson Finet of Madison, Wis., Barbara Sorenson Stolberg of Forest Lake, Minn., Dr. John Sorenson of Royal Oak, Mich., David Sorenson of Milwaukee, Bonnie Aplin Pring of Colorado Springs, Colo., Laurie Aplin of Colorado Springs, Colo., David Aplin of Denver, Colo. and Bill Aplin of Chicago, Ill. and three great grandchildren, Aaron Pring, Sarah Sorenson and Nicole Finet. She was preceded in death by a son, Ensgin Robert Tills who was killed during World War II and a brother, Andrew Petersen in 1959.
